LM12L458 Features

  • Three operating modes: 12-bit + sign, 8-bit + sign, and "watchdog"
  • Single-ended or differential inputs
  • Built-in Sample-and-Hold
  • Instruction RAM and event sequencer
  • 8-channel multiplexer
  • 32-word conversion FIFO
  • Programmable acquisition times and conversion rates
  • Self-calibration and diagnostic mode
  • 8- or 16-bit wide databus microprocessor or DSP interface
  • CMOS compatible I/O

LM12L458 Description

    The LM12L458 is a highly integrated 3.3V Data Acquisition System. It combines a fully-differential self-calibrating (correcting linearity and zero errors) 13-bit (12-bit + sign) analog-to-digital converter (ADC) and sample-and-hold (S/H) with extensive analog functions and digital functionality. Up to 32 consecutive conversions, using two's complement format, can be stored in an internal 32-word (16-bit wide) FIFO data buffer. An internal 8-word RAM can store the conversion sequence for up to eight acquisitions through the LM12L458's eight-input multiplexer. The LM12L458 can also operate with 8-bit + sign resolution and in a supervisory "watchdog" mode that compares an input signal against two programmable limits. Programmable acquisition times and conversion rates are possible through the use of internal clock-driven timers.

    All registers, RAM, and FIFO are directly addressable through the high speed microprocessor interface to either an 8-bit or 16-bit databus. The LM12L458 includes a direct memory access (DMA) interface for high-speed conversion data transfer.
